Features at a Glance

The Echo CS-4600 chainsaw includes features such as a high-performance engine, automatic oiling system, and a tool-less air filter for easy maintenance.

FeatureDescription
Engine Displacement45.0 cc
Bar Length16 to 20 inches
Weight10.1 lbs
Fuel Capacity14.9 fl oz
Chain TypeLow profile
Oiling SystemAutomatic

Operation Instructions

To start the chainsaw, follow these steps:

  1. Ensure the chainsaw is on a stable surface.
  2. Engage the chain brake.
  3. Prime the fuel bulb.
  4. Pull the starter rope until the engine fires.
  5. Release the chain brake and begin cutting.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Chainsaw won't startFuel issueCheck fuel level and quality; ensure proper fuel mixture.
Chain not movingChain tensionAdjust chain tension; check for obstructions.
Excessive vibrationWorn chainInspect and replace chain if necessary.
Oil not dispensingClogged oil portClean oil port and check oil level.
